Quick answer

Chakbanni is a village in Muhammadabad Gohna Tehsil of Mau district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 197270.

About Chakbanni village record

Chakbanni is listed under Muhammadabad Gohna Tehsil in Mau district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 170, 24 households, area 51.87 hectares, PIN code 000000.
